The 27th Satellite Awards is an award ceremony honoring the year's outstanding performers, films and television shows, presented by the International Press Academy.
The nominations were announced on December 8, 2022.[1][2][3] The winners were announced on March 3, 2023.[1][4][5][6] The awards presentation took place at the Beverly Hills Hotel.[7]
Top Gun: Maverick led the film nominations with 10, followed by Babylon, Elvis and The Fabelmans with nine each.[3] Better Call Saul's sixth and final season, and The Righteous Gemstones led the television nominations with four each.[3] Six of the special achievement award recipients were announced on January 13, 2023; however, the Mary Pickford Award recipient was announced on February 22, 2023.[1][8][9][10]
- Auteur Award (for singular vision and unique artistic control over the elements of production) – Martin McDonagh
- Honorary Satellite Award – RRR
- Humanitarian Award (for making a difference in the lives of those in the artistic community and beyond) – Joe Mantegna
- Mary Pickford Award (for outstanding artistic contribution to the entertainment industry) – Diane Warren
- Nikola Tesla Award (for visionary achievement in filmmaking technology) – Ryan Tudhope
- Breakthrough Performance Award – Bhavin Rabari (Last Film Show)
- Stunt Performance Award – Casey O'Neill (Top Gun: Maverick)
- Ensemble: Motion Picture – Glass Onion: A Knives Out Mystery
- Ensemble: Television – Winning Time: The Rise of the Lakers Dynasty
